Dividends Summary
- Consistent Payer: Smith & Nephew plc has rewarded shareholders with 46 dividend payments over the past 23 years.
- Total Returned Value: Investors who held SNN shares during this period received a total of $17.17 per share in dividend income.
- Latest Payout: The most recent dividend of $0.48/share was paid 52 days ago, on May 27, 2026.
- Dividend Growth: Since 2003, the dividend payout has decreased by 11.2%, from $0.54 to $0.48.

Smith+Nephew announced the US launch of its next generation LEAF Patient Monitoring System, a cloud-based platform designed to prevent hospital-acquired pressure injuries (HAPIs). Smith+Nephew is launching two new wound care products at the European Wound Management Association Conference in May 2026: ALLEVYN COMPLETE CARE Foam Dressing with enhanced exudate management and pressure ulcer prevention, and RENASYS EDGE Negative Pressure Wound Therapy System designed for simplicity and patient compliance.
